Technical Considerations for Stitching
From a technical standpoint, a "fun and colorful" design usually implies multiple thread changes and potentially dense satin stitching for the text and borders. While this creates a vibrant look, it also means we need to be mindful of stitch density. High-density designs can sometimes cause puckering on lighter fabrics like thin cotton tees or linen towels. My recommendation is to always create a sample stitch-out on the exact fabric you intend to sell. Test the design with different stabilizer types—perhaps a cut-away for stretchy sweatshirts and a tear-away for stable tote bags—to ensure the best finish.

Final Seller Notes and Licensing
Before adding this School Senior Embroidery Design to your inventory, there are a few practical steps every responsible creative entrepreneur should take. First, review the licensing terms on the Creative Fabrica product page thoroughly. While most files on the platform come with a commercial license allowing you to sell finished physical goods, terms can vary, and some restrictions may apply regarding print-on-demand services versus handmade items. Ensure you are compliant to protect your shop.
Second, verify the file formats included. Whether you use Brother, Janome, Husqvarna, or Bernina machines, you need to ensure the embroidery file formats provided match your equipment. If the listing does not explicitly state the stitch count or compatible formats, contact the designer or check the detailed description tab before purchasing. Finally, consider the readability of the design. At the smallest size (3.8 inches), ensure that the "2026" text and any smaller details remain legible after stitching. If the text becomes too small to read clearly, stick to using the larger sizes for apparel where detail retention is easier to manage.
